Output 59dc66c2ecc783a5e0d2d8bc6180b8972001eee732bd158ae844dac2c262a28d:0

value
7516568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c3bb0c0c9aabce9fe5fcaf6d286c0a92a4d95cc OP_EQUALVERIFY OP_CHECKSIG
address
1JAHYRsCpUChboERYBjrxEs9XkH4CVkvc4
transaction
59dc66c2ecc783a5e0d2d8bc6180b8972001eee732bd158ae844dac2c262a28d
confirmations
346063
spent
true